Looking a little closer StreamableMemoryObject.h does have some seemingly
redundant overrides.

And this override of a non-pure virtual with a pure virtual

  virtual int readBytes(uint64_t address,
                        uint64_t size,
                        uint8_t *buf) const override = 0;

>>>>>> clang-modernize can add the 'override', but it can't currently delete
>>>>>> 'virtual'. It will also potentially overflow 80 columns. And if it removed
>>>>>> virtual it would fail to align a second line of arguments correctly. So you
>>>>>> need modernize and clang-format I guess. Though I'm not sure we want to
>>>>>> widespread apply clang-format.
